hiwayman Sep 28th, 02, 06:01 PM I also am from WI and have not seen the car, but would be happy to help look. I have no personal interest in an El Camino. You might make a winter project of checking with local car clubs. I am going to visit DMV archives this week but don't know if they will have 69 info. You could search for any currently registered 69 El Caminos. If they had personalized plates they may be a tipoff to the COPO or 427, etc. You could narrow down your search alot. If the car is no longer in WI but was 6 or 7 years ago start looking for El Caminos registered then less the one registered now.

ElCamino VIN will start different than other bodies and model year 69 will be different also. By doing a VIN search for all VIN's that begin with ElCamino Body type and year 69 you will narrow your search down to registered 69 ElCaminos. Check for lic. plate #s on these for personalized plate clues. After this that policeman friend of yours comes in handy as he/she can get names and addresses. Good Luck

hiwayman Sep 30th, 02, 08:03 AM Almost forgot. Records older than 7 years are stored at the Wis. Historical Society and you need to search those in person in Madison. In theory the same gag rule on owners personal info still applies but if its on the microfich it has not been removed. The staff at the socity can help show you where to begin and probablly get you pretty close.
